"Independent People" is the saga-like retelling of the life of an ordinary poor peasant, Byartur. As the author tells it, his labor for twenty years on a small plot of land is truly heroic β worthy of the heroes of ancient tales. Frequent mentions of old sagas, and the heroic poems skillfully woven into the narrative by the author, as well as separate episodes of the novel that make you remember folk epics β all of this creates an atmosphere of epic solemnity and high poetic spirit.
